Why HVAC Isn’t Enough for Grow Room Humidity Control
WebFeb 25, 2024 · The necessary humidity range for most indoor crops lies between 3-55%, with an ideal target range of 40-45%. Humidity rising above 60% can lead to molds, mildews, and other unwanted biological growth. Furthermore, high humidity prevents plants from properly taking in CO 2, preventing efficient photosynthesis. WebThe ideal humidity range for plants is 40-50% during vegging and flowering, but seedlings and clones need humidity of 70-75%. Humidifiers and dehumidifiers Growers will implement humidifiers to add moisture into the growing space, and dehumidifiers to remove moisture from the growing space.
